The Rev. Claude Sylvester Turner, Jr. passed away on Wednesday, October 12, 2016 after an extended illness. A native of Martinsville, Va., Mr. Turner was the son of Claude S. and Amy Lucile (Clanton) Turner, Sr. He was married to the Rev. Mollie (Douglas) Turner.

A graduate of Georgia Tech, he was a veteran of the Navy, and for many years he served as an Episcopal priest in the diocese of Southern Virginia. Besides his wife, Mr. Turner leaves behind a son, George Turner; a daughter, Lee Richards (Russell); and a sister, Mary Ann Dee. He was preceded in death by his first wife, Alice (Leelee) Tucker.

A Memorial Service will be on Sunday, October 16 at 3 p.m. at the Episcopal Church of the Holy Cross located at 150 Melrose Ave., Tryon, N.C. Interment will take place at a later date in Virginia.
